Made with an 11% blend of AHAs (glycolic, lactic, phytic, citric) and BHAs (salicylic acid) this overnight serum gently scoops away dead skin cells and helps clear pores of excess sebum. Its plant oils and humectants buffer the potentially harsh effects of chemical exfoliants by providing nourishing moisture to the skin, allowing the serum to remain balanced and gentle. Further antioxidants and moth bean extract (a natural retinol alternative) repair the skin cells and clean up free radicals which cause fine lines and discolouration, thus helping to diminish the appearance of pores.
Best for dull, uneven, rough, or congested skin that could use an overnight resurface.
Key ingredients include:
AHAs (glycolic, lactic, phytic, citric) - These chemical exfoliants have large enough molecules so as not to penetrate the skin, making them gentle surface workers, loosening dead skin cells.
BHA (salicylic acid) - This exfoliating acid has a smaller-sized molecule that can penetrate pores to help rid them of blackheads and excess sebum to decongest and diminish their appearance.
Moth Bean Extract - A natural alternative to retinol, this boosts collagen production and stimulates cell turnover.
Coconut Water & Aloe Leaf Juice - Full of nutrients, vitamins, and antioxidants, these both possess hydrating as well as anti-inflammatory and anti-microbial properties.
Sodium Hyaluronate - The salt form of hyaluronic acid that’s more skin-compatible than HA.
Rosehip Oil - A regenerative and brightening oil, rosehip oil’s abundant vitamins and antioxidants make this a powerful skin tone evening ingredient.
Tamanu Oil - With anti-inflammatory, wound-healing, and collagen-boosting properties, tamanu oil’s antioxidant- and essential fatty acid-rich make-up have made this a skin hero.
Prickly Pear Oil - Highly hydrating, this cactus-derived oil is rich in vitamin E, essential fatty acids, amino acids, and omega 6 and 9, which help boost the skin barrier’s health and moisture retention capabilities.
Raspberry Seed Oil - Super anti-inflammatory and moisturising, this oil’s generous antioxidant and essential fatty acid content help to combat oxidative stress and aid cell regeneration.
Rice Extract - With amino acids, vitamin E and ferulic acid, the protein in rice extract is skin-soothing and hydrating, but also a powerhouse with evening out pigmentation and brightening tone overall.
Watermelon Extract - The vitamin C and antioxidants in this ingredient help to moisturise and exfoliate, while promoting cell regeneration as well.
Lentil Extract - This works in conjunction with other fruit and plant extracts (like watermelon) to help moisturise skin.
Green Tea Leaf Extract - An antioxidant boss, green tea extract repairs free radical damage to skin cells while promoting healthy renewal and cell function.
Apply a thin layer to the face and neck after cleansing and toning. Follow with moisturiser. Can be used a couple of times a week or even every night, depending on your skin’s tolerance to acids, but not with other exfoliating products. Always wear SPF, especially the day after using the Halo serum.
